What is the ruling on the work of an accountant who is forced to reduce the amounts of tax deducted from employees, after his repeated attempts to correct the matter, and is his salary considered lawful?
You have done well in clarifying the truth, enjoining good, forbidding evil, and a Muslim's fulfilling of his obligations in this regard will not be harmed by the misguidance of those who are astray. If you strongly suspect that the officials are manipulating matters to cause the loss of employees' rights, then you must inform them of this. Your work in the company is permissible as long as it is in what is lawful, and your salary is permissible. Your remaining in the work while advising the officials is better than leaving it, if it does not directly lead to what is forbidden or assist in it, because your staying might expose injustices and allow you to advise the officials. In offering advice, follow effective methods, with wisdom and good admonition, patience, choosing appropriate times, and utilizing da'wah (preaching) means, along with supplication and prayer for the officials' guidance.
